Abstract
The arbuscular mycorrhiza (AM) association between plants and biotrophic fungi and the legume-rhizobia symbiosis (LRS) between legume plants and nitrogen-fixing bacteria are two mutualistic symbioses of critical importance in nature and sustainable agriculture. Phytohormones are involved in the regulation of both interactions. This review summarizes the current knowledge about the role of jasmonates in AM and LRS.
